Is Mango a Zara?

Background Founded in 1984 in Barcelona by two Turkish brothers, Isak and Nahman Andic, who had immigrated to Spain. With more than 2,000 stores in 103 countries, Mango is one of Zara’s biggest competitors. …

Are Zara and Mango related?

Her misconception that Mango is one of Zara owner Inditex’s cluster of brands is common. In fact, the 30-year-old Barcelona-based company is private and unrelated to the world’s largest retailer, based in Galicia, northern Spain.

Who owns Zara in India?

Inditex
Zara operates in India through the association of its parent Spanish clothing company Inditex with the Tata group firm Trent Ltd – Inditex Trent Retail India Private Limited (ITRIPL). The Inditex group of Spain owns 51 per cent while Trent has 49 per cent.
